  Chapter 126 On how the little girl sold herself?

   "Sister-in-law, I have nothing to do, don't worry, I definitely can't do stupid things!"

  Looking at the concerned Shen Wanwan, Ji Jinxin wiped away his tears, forcing himself to suppress his sadness.

  She can't let her sister-in-law worry about her. If she just wants to digest this matter, maybe she can forget about that dead scumbag after crying a bit!

  Gu Chuyan said that scumbag is really too cheap, the more Ji Jinxin thinks about it, the more angry he gets, so he just doesn't want to think about it anymore.

   After all, the more you think about this scumbag, the more irritating you become. There is no need to make yourself feel better, because this scumbag will make you worse.

  Since the scumbags are empathizing with each other, I wish you scumbags and **** forever!

   It's not like no one wants it, so don't play with this scumbag!

   "If you don't want to tell sister-in-law, then don't say it, but if you want to go out, you must tell sister-in-law, and I will go with you when the time comes."

  Shen Wanwan has always been worried about Ji Jinxin's passing away at a young age in the book, so she pays special attention to the time when Ji Jinxin goes out.

  However, there should be a big difference between this life and the plot in the book, at least in the book, Ji Jinxin is still at home at this time and entangled with that scumbag.

  But now the plot has to be changed directly, and Ji Jinxin, the most important character, is taken away directly, and the two of them have no entangled plot at all.

  So the next thing will not happen, or the world in the book will automatically complete the unfinished plot?

  Shen Wanwan was very distressed. She hesitated whether to continue reminding Ji Jinxin to be careful and not to run around.

  Unexpectedly, Ji Jinxin was the first to cheer up. Ji Jinxin took out his mobile phone and prepared to surf the Internet.

   "Sister-in-law, you can go and accompany my brother. Don't worry, I'm fine. There are thousands of men in the world. Without Gu Chuyan, a scumbag, it's not like I can't live."

  Ji Jinxin is very free and easy, she is not the kind of person who can't afford to let go, since the other party has someone she likes, she will choose to stay away and silently bless.

   "That's fine, you are well, so that your brother and I can rest assured."

   Seeing that Ji Jinxin was really fine, Shen Wanwan finally breathed a sigh of relief, as long as Ji Jinxin's sister-in-law is doing well, the atmosphere of the whole Ji family will become very good.

   After all, no one would like to watch their family leave in front of them...

   "It's okay, sister-in-law, you can go down quickly."

  Ji Jinxin waved her hand, she didn't plan to have breakfast any more, she was going to take out her mobile phone to swipe at this time, maybe she could meet a handsome guy?

"I'm leaving."

  Shen Wanwan reluctantly left the room, not forgetting to close the door of Ji Jinxin's room before leaving.

  As soon as Shen Wanwan left, Ji Jinxin opened Weibo, but within two minutes Ji Jinxin closed Weibo again.

  The Weibo was uninstalled backhandedly. This Weibo was all news about that scumbag Gu Chuyan. Ji Jinxin didn't want to see him at all now, let alone news about Gu Chuyan.

   Uninstalled is better, out of sight is out of mind!

  After uninstalling Weibo, Ji Jinxin clicked on her own QQ and directly entered a certain artist group, and began to check chat records.

  After reading the chat history, Ji Jinxin walked to the window with his mobile phone and took a photo of the sea view and sent it to the group.

   It didn't take long to attract attention, and everyone commented on the bottom, saying that the sea view is beautiful. Among them, a person named "Xiaolu" asked Ji Jinxin if he had any more beautiful photos.

   Ji Jinxin originally wanted to take a few more photos of this person, but unexpectedly received a friend request from him.

  Ji Jinxin moved her finger, and directly approved the friend application, and the other party sent a message just after the application was passed.

  Xiaolu: "Ari, do you have any good photos?"

  Looking at the information on the screen, Ji Jinxin moved his fingers slightly, and sent several pictures of the scenery here to the other party.

  From this moment on, the two gradually became acquainted. Xiaolu was very enthusiastic and often took the initiative to stir up topics.

   Compared with the other party, Ji Jinxin's topics are relatively less. She is not very used to dealing with boys, and she will hesitate for a long time when answering messages.

  Ji Jinxin was a little overwhelmed by the sudden intrusion into his own life, and the two chatted like this for several days, and even made an appointment to draw manuscripts together at night.

  Both of them are painters, but Ah Hua's manuscripts are of different types, but they can save the manuscripts and chat together.

  Xiaolu is very curious about the city where Ji Jinxin lives, and has always wanted to come and see it.

  Xiaolu: "Ari, if I have a chance, I will definitely visit your place."

  Ji Jinxin: "When you have a chance to come over, I'll show you around our side."

  Xiaolu has been making promises, and Ji Jinxin has also been promising each other, and the relationship between the two is getting better and better.

  After chatting like this for several days, Xiaolu suddenly brought up a bet. The two had also bet before, but it was Ji Jinxin who didn't see the rules clearly.

  I thought I had won, but when I looked at the rules, I found out that I had lost.

   This loss directly became Xiaolu's younger brother. Ji Jinxin thought that the relationship between the two was just like this, but he didn't expect him to bet again that night.

  Xiaolu: "A Li, why don't we bet to see who can finish the painting first and fastest?"

  Xiaolu: "If you lose, spend a day with me tomorrow, even for a while, and I'll take a photo and post it on Moments."

  Looking at this answer, the first thought that popped up in Ji Jinxin's mind was...

  Ji Jinxin: "Isn't there another routine?"

  Ji Jinxin: "You didn't do it on purpose, then I lose, right?"

   Facing Ji Jinxin's words, Xiaolu behaved very innocently.

  Xiaolu: "How is that possible?"

  Xiaolu: "Is it any good for me if you lose?"

  Looking at Xiaolu's tone, Ji Jinxin nodded in doubt, and began to paint very hard.

  In the end, I found that I lost again, and this loss directly outputted myself...

  Ji Jinxin didn't want to admit the gamble, so she threw the lock screen of her phone on the bed and fell asleep under the quilt, only to wake up the next day to find out that it was Qixi Festival.

  Looking at the message sent by the other party early in the morning, Ji Jinxin struggled whether to reply, but in the end she still replied.

  The two chatted briefly, and Xiaolu brought up the topic.

  Xiaolu: "A Li, do you still remember our bet yesterday?"

  Looking at this message, Ji Jinxin really wanted not to reply, and really wanted to tell him that he didn't remember.

  But still typed two words like a ghost.

  Ji Jinxin: "Remember."

   Xiaolu at the other end responded quickly, and it didn't take long for the message to come.

  Xiaolu: "Then I'll go flirt!"

  Ji Jinxin looked at the other party's anxious appearance, and felt an urge to escape, but he still sent the message.

  Ji Jinxin: "Okay."

   Not long after, Xiaolu sent over the lovers he found, and asked Ji Jinxin which one would he like?

  Ji Jinxin flipped through the chat records, and chose a random one after looking at those romances.

   Feeling and object relations go too fast.

   It feels like a dream, the distance between me and him is more than 2,000 kilometers!

   So tangled~

  (end of this chapter)
